START sys/netinet/bindconnect 2024-10-15T12:27:48Z ==== setup-maxfiles ==== [[ $(sysctl -n kern.maxfiles) -ge 110000 ]] || sysctl kern.maxfiles=110000 kern.maxfiles: 2950 -> 110000 ==== run-default ==== cc -O2 -pipe -Wall -Wpointer-arith -Wuninitialized -Wstrict-prototypes -Wmissing-prototypes -Wunused -Wsign-compare -Wshadow -MD -MP -c /usr/src/regress/sys/netinet/bindconnect/bindconnect.c cc -o bindconnect bindconnect.o -lpthread time ./bindconnect count: socket 250702, close 1577401, bind 1022799, connect 842550, delroute 0 10.01 real 3.01 user 6.98 sys ==== run-inet-udp-bind ==== time ./bindconnect -f inet -p udp -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 336952, close 741711, bind 2176745, connect 0, delroute 0 10.02 real 2.40 user 7.58 sys ==== run-inet-udp-connect ==== time ./bindconnect -f inet -p udp -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 281825, close 799110, bind 0, connect 1155353, delroute 0 10.02 real 2.05 user 7.95 sys ==== run-inet-udp-bind-connect ==== time ./bindconnect -f inet -p udp -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 278092, close 620130, bind 1193822, connect 570534, delroute 0 10.02 real 2.26 user 7.71 sys ==== run-inet-udp-100000 ==== SKIPPED ==== run-inet-udp-reuseport ==== time ./bindconnect -f inet -p udp -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 272787, close 550226, bind 1244545, connect 798717, delroute 0 10.02 real 2.37 user 7.63 sys ==== run-inet-udp-localnet-connect ==== SKIPPED ==== run-inet-udp-localnet-bind-connect ==== SKIPPED ==== run-inet-udp-localnet-connect-delete ==== SKIPPED ==== run-inet-tcp-bind ==== time ./bindconnect -f inet -p tcp -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 127240, close 578467, bind 2255253, connect 0, delroute 0 10.02 real 2.43 user 7.35 sys ==== run-inet-tcp-connect ==== time ./bindconnect -f inet -p tcp -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 127257, close 619720, bind 0, connect 1974753, delroute 0 10.02 real 2.95 user 6.95 sys ==== run-inet-tcp-bind-connect ==== time ./bindconnect -f inet -p tcp -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 121089, close 634521, bind 1329077, connect 1250451, delroute 0 10.02 real 2.97 user 6.89 sys ==== run-inet-tcp-100000 ==== SKIPPED ==== run-inet-tcp-reuseport ==== time ./bindconnect -f inet -p tcp -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 125414, close 658643, bind 1179330, connect 1292479, delroute 0 10.02 real 2.90 user 6.95 sys ==== run-inet-tcp-localnet-connect ==== SKIPPED ==== run-inet-tcp-localnet-bind-connect ==== SKIPPED ==== run-inet-tcp-localnet-connect-delete ==== SKIPPED ==== run-inet-any-bind ==== time ./bindconnect -f inet -p any -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 211313, close 552960, bind 2453430, connect 0, delroute 0 10.02 real 2.51 user 7.54 sys ==== run-inet-any-connect ==== time ./bindconnect -f inet -p any -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 251417, close 571697, bind 0, connect 1423233, delroute 0 10.02 real 2.37 user 7.60 sys ==== run-inet-any-bind-connect ==== time ./bindconnect -f inet -p any -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 256750, close 616388, bind 735137, connect 659336, delroute 0 10.02 real 2.06 user 7.93 sys ==== run-inet-any-100000 ==== SKIPPED ==== run-inet-any-reuseport ==== time ./bindconnect -f inet -p any -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 248459, close 691055, bind 994084, connect 506742, delroute 0 10.02 real 1.88 user 8.17 sys ==== run-inet-any-localnet-connect ==== SKIPPED ==== run-inet-any-localnet-bind-connect ==== SKIPPED ==== run-inet-any-localnet-connect-delete ==== SKIPPED ==== run-inet6-udp-bind ==== time ./bindconnect -f inet6 -p udp -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 271509, close 534110, bind 2160141, connect 0, delroute 0 10.01 real 2.14 user 7.82 sys ==== run-inet6-udp-connect ==== time ./bindconnect -f inet6 -p udp -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 276327, close 680439, bind 0, connect 824693, delroute 0 10.02 real 1.38 user 8.63 sys ==== run-inet6-udp-bind-connect ==== time ./bindconnect -f inet6 -p udp -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 272856, close 634180, bind 965041, connect 123398, delroute 0 10.02 real 1.47 user 8.51 sys ==== run-inet6-udp-100000 ==== SKIPPED ==== run-inet6-udp-reuseport ==== time ./bindconnect -f inet6 -p udp -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 274777, close 762151, bind 1045760, connect 668052, delroute 0 10.02 real 2.34 user 7.62 sys ==== run-inet6-udp-localnet-connect ==== SKIPPED ==== run-inet6-udp-localnet-bind-connect ==== SKIPPED ==== run-inet6-udp-localnet-connect-delete ==== SKIPPED ==== run-inet6-tcp-bind ==== time ./bindconnect -f inet6 -p tcp -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 88651, close 432586, bind 2005266, connect 0, delroute 0 10.02 real 1.92 user 8.02 sys ==== run-inet6-tcp-connect ==== time ./bindconnect -f inet6 -p tcp -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 132561, close 729911, bind 0, connect 2432218, delroute 0 10.02 real 3.39 user 6.48 sys ==== run-inet6-tcp-bind-connect ==== time ./bindconnect -f inet6 -p tcp -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 84124, close 496223, bind 1949820, connect 821810, delroute 0 10.02 real 3.10 user 6.81 sys ==== run-inet6-tcp-100000 ==== SKIPPED ==== run-inet6-tcp-reuseport ==== time ./bindconnect -f inet6 -p tcp -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 97715, close 575321, bind 1916097, connect 1135989, delroute 0 10.02 real 3.22 user 6.67 sys ==== run-inet6-tcp-localnet-connect ==== SKIPPED ==== run-inet6-tcp-localnet-bind-connect ==== SKIPPED ==== run-inet6-tcp-localnet-connect-delete ==== SKIPPED ==== run-inet6-any-bind ==== time ./bindconnect -f inet6 -p any -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 188983, close 708173, bind 1924925, connect 0, delroute 0 10.01 real 2.09 user 7.88 sys ==== run-inet6-any-connect ==== time ./bindconnect -f inet6 -p any -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 238647, close 493361, bind 0, connect 1338867, delroute 0 10.02 real 1.93 user 8.11 sys ==== run-inet6-any-bind-connect ==== time ./bindconnect -f inet6 -p any -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 200326, close 535768, bind 920286, connect 675486, delroute 0 10.02 real 1.89 user 8.14 sys ==== run-inet6-any-100000 ==== SKIPPED ==== run-inet6-any-reuseport ==== time ./bindconnect -f inet6 -p any -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 208949, close 571315, bind 1161584, connect 626062, delroute 0 10.02 real 2.26 user 7.71 sys ==== run-inet6-any-localnet-connect ==== SKIPPED ==== run-inet6-any-localnet-bind-connect ==== SKIPPED ==== run-inet6-any-localnet-connect-delete ==== SKIPPED SKIP sys/netinet/bindconnect Test skipped itself